29 CFR 1910.1200(e)(1): The employer did not develop, implement, and/or maintain at the workplace a written hazard communication program which describes how the criteria specified in 29 CFR 1910.1200(f), (g), and (h) will be met: (a) Foxx Equipment Company at 955 Decatur St. Denver, CO 80204: On or before 8/2/18 the employer did not develop or implement a written hazard communication program in accordance with this standard. This condition exposed employees to hazardous chemicals including but not limited to: -welding fumes -hexavalent chromium -toluene -alkanoamines -D-limonene

29 CFR 1910.1200(g)(1): Employers did not have a safety data sheet in the workplace for each hazardous chemical which they use: (a) Foxx Equipment Company at 955 Decatur St. Denver, CO 80204: On or before 8/2/18 the employer did not maintain Safety Data Sheets for each hazardous chemical they used in accordance with this standard.

29 CFR 1910.1200(h)(1): Employees were not provided effective information and training on hazardous chemicals in their work area at the time of their initial assignment and whenever a new hazard that the employees had not been previously trained about was introduced into their work area: (a) Foxx Equipment Company at 955 Decatur St. Denver, CO 80204: On or before 8/2/18 the employer did not provide effective training and information on the hazardous chemicals used at this workplace in accordance with this standard. This condition exposed employees to hazardous chemicals including but not limited to: -welding fumes -hexavalent chromium -toluene -alkanoamines -D-limonene

29 CFR 1910.252(c)(1)(iv): The employer did not include the potentially hazardous materials employed in fluxes, coatings, coverings, and filler metals, all of which are potentially used in welding and cutting, in the program established to comply with Hazard Communication Standard (HCS) (sec. 1910.1200): (a) Foxx Equipment Company at 955 Decatur St. Denver, CO 80204: On or before 8/2/18 the employer did not include the hazardous materials involved with welding in the required written hazard communication program. This condition exposed employees to hazardous chemicals including but not limited to: -welding fumes -hexavalent chromium

29 CFR 1910.1026(l)(1)(iii): The employer had not included chromium (VI) in the hazard communication program, established to comply with the Hazard Communication Standard, 29 CFR 1910.1200, ensured that each employee had access to labels on containers of chromium (VI) and to safety data sheets, and was trained in accordance with the requirements of the Hazard Communication Standard and 29 CFR 1910.1026(l)(2), including the contents of the Hexavalent Chromium Standard, the purpose and a description of the medical surveillance program, and made copies of this standard available to all affected employees: (a) Foxx Equipment Company at 955 Decatur St. Denver, CO 80204: On or before 8/2/18 the employer did not include chromium (VI) in the required written hazard communication program, hazard communication training and safety data sheets. This condition exposed employees to chromium (VI).

29 CFR 1910.132(d)(1): The employer did not assess the workplace to determine if hazards are present, or are likely to be present, which necessitate the use of personal protective equipment (PPE): (a) Foxx Equipment Company at 955 Decatur St. Denver, CO 80204: On or before 8/2/18 the employer did not assess the workplace to determine which hazards were present that necessitated the use of personal protective equipment. Shop employees do not wear protective clothing while welding, grinding and operating machinery. This condition exposed employees to radiant energy from the welding arc as well as flying chips and sparks from grinding.

29 CFR 1910.1026(d)(1): The employer with a workplace or work operation covered by this standard did not determine the 8-hour time-weighted average exposure for each employee exposed to chromium (VI): (a) Foxx Equipment Company at 955 Decatur St. Denver, CO 80204: On or before 8/2/18 the employer did not determine the 8 hour time-weighted-average exposure for each employee exposed to chromium (VI). The employer did not evaluate the respiratory hazards associated with welding stainless steel and establish controls. This condition exposed employees to chromium (VI).
